Day0

和boshi、Rayment组的队,昨天听学长说这次比赛可以加学分,他们信科的大部分人都会参加,估摸有两百多支队伍——然而奖品只有不到一百份 我要奖品呐!

上午十一点半到的北京,拉着行李提着桶水买了块汉堡就打车去了北大附中。在门口居然没被查证件

到了签到场地碰到了高咱六届的学长,签到领了三块牌牌(到后来才发现是“志愿者”而不是“参赛选手”?)

由于还没吃午饭,就先放了试机去吃汉堡。结果就是比赛场地没有Linux和其他的高级windows编辑器,最后只能委屈使用dev-c++

开场打算使用学长的策略——将题目分为三份,三线程解题……然而我题目还没开始看,boshi就秒切了A,WA了两次,所以我们决定这次比赛不管罚时只管题数(左边的队伍正在思考;我们过了一题;右边的队伍已经切了两题了)

志愿者送了个气球来,我才想起acm比赛时有气球送的,而后又送了一大袋零食(真的是“一大袋”,估摸够两个人不吃饭吃一天的)

我正在看E,觉得会比较套路,给boshi讲了下题意后就立马想到了个类似于NOI2015寿司晚宴的做法……打了一半后发现假了(左边的队伍在思考;我们暂无进展;右边的队伍已经切三题了)

随后看榜发现F有一堆队伍过了,估摸着不难,看了下数据范围,应该是道暴力枚举加模拟(但是英语不好题目看不懂呐)。题目大概是关于北大学分计算的,读了好久题才勉强读懂(埋下隐患)。打完一交就WA,仔细研读了一遍代码后被Rayment提醒是不是题目没读全,然后再次细读题面,发现我漏了第一段的两个约束,调完一交仍WA……又查了一会儿发现选的课程需要排序?坑爹阅读理解题(左边的队伍在思考;我们过了两题;右边的队伍已经切四题了)

趁着我丢人现眼敲F的时候,boshi和Rayment想出了C题的假解法,于是赶紧去敲……敲完发现WA了(左边的队伍在思考;右边的队伍暂无进展)

后来不知道怎么的,boshi居然把D这个充满物理名词的题面看懂了,是个fwt裸题,迅速敲敲敲过了(左边的队伍貌似发现了F是最简单的,开始码码码;我们过了三题;右边的队伍暂无进展)

接下来很长一段时间都没啥进展,直到boshi发现K是一个旋转卡壳,虽然有点难码,但鉴于没啥进展就开始码了……中途发了个题目修正,发现不用特判了,就好码一些了,最后WA了好几次,但都过了对拍,后来发现是输出少了个.,改改就过了(左边的队伍没过F,正在讨论解法;我们过了四题;右边的队伍切了五题了)

仍然没有什么进展,榜上切的比较多的是E,但是一直想的是转前缀后主席树分块维护或者是直接在线莫队,思路被局限了……然后boshi上了个厕所回来就切了,神仙!大致是对每个数存倍数,然后询问时对质因子容斥(左边的队伍正在讨论怎么开数组;我们过了五题;右边的队伍切了七题了)

期间还改了几次C题的代码,但仍WA……我想到了 I 的一个 \(O(n\log n)\) 做法(左边的队伍终于过了 F,已经收拾东西走了)

时间不多了,现在有三个选择:

  • 继续改C,但不能确保正确
  • 去尝试打 I,不能保证不会T
  • 去打G,大概率调不出

民主投票决定开 I……然后下考前都没调出来(人生污点)

最终凭借着超高的罚时,拿到了rank21,预计是有二等奖(每人一个小米手环),还是不错的,就是I没调出来有点悲伤

晚上吃了必胜客 然后拉肚子 就去cts的宾馆了。我和一个雅礼小哥住,boshi和一个黑龙江大哥住,Rayment由于不参加cts就自己开了间房住

刚进房间就被雅礼小哥提换房,换到新房后发现是同校高一的dra

Day1

比闹钟早一分钟醒

上厕所时发现宾馆浴缸裂了、地板也是裂的  ̄□ ̄||

到了首师附吃早饭,他们校校服有五种颜色(目测) 而且女生比例莫名的高

食堂自助,虽然不错但比不上八十中;参观学校也是,虽然不错但比不上八十中;和八十中同是小班教学。唯一一点印象就是他们信息竞赛教室为独栋小平房,设计前卫(非传统教室布局,类似于创客中心)、设备高级(配备苹果最贵电脑、个人垃圾桶)、窗明几净(独栋一楼,采光面积大),环境比我们好到不知哪里去,再有就是他们学校的体育课与写生课比例真高

考场分布在四个不同的地方,而且都不注明位置,只写个“公共教室、高考教室”……找了半天找到了考场,进去后发现设备还是比较高级,和去年八十中差不多

8:27进去后老师就说不准动键盘,还很凶的样子 我就乖乖地发呆,然后直到8:40,我瞄到其他人好像都开始看题了,我才怯怯地问了下监考“现在能动键盘了吗”,监考:“早就可以动了”……

发现t3是提答,那说明前两题还比较可做(flag)

t1是三维空间里算极值数量的概率的题,我在考场上以为这题和前几年一道tjoi的题很像,觉得是变种(flag)……然后我一直没有想法,一直在想出题人给 \(50\%\)
的部分分 \(k=1\) 怎么做(flag),最后除了一个 \(O(n^9)\) 暴力别无想法,于是就很不情愿地交了 \(O((nml)!)\) 的暴力

t2题面比较简短,吸取wc的经验,“白云”一定是陈江伦出的不可做母函数,然后写了 \(O(Dn)\)
的暴力,看到 \(D\leq 300\),发现矩乘会 T 就没打,看到 \(m\leq 2\) 的几个点,不想讨论加了俩特判就交了

t3提答题面还比较简单,是道计算几何,手玩了两个点熟悉了题面,第三个点也很顺利地填出来了,第四个点不能手玩,但很有特征,写了个构造程序捣腾两下,后面的点就不知道咋整了,写了个暴力贪心只能搞 \(type=2\),总共搞到10分……

出来后常规操作发现大家都ak了

讲题发现

  • t1出题人不会 \(k=1\)!?我那个 \(O(n^9)\) 的做法复杂度是假的,大伙儿酱紫拿 \(30\) 分!?
  • t2矩乘可以卡过!?标算果真是母函数!?
  • t3大伙儿都会70+!?

自闭了……

Day2

更自闭了……

换到了个“公共教室”,机子很烂,屏幕超小,键盘强行插了个外接(预示着我今天爆零)

t1一开场想到可以贪心合并凸包,但是想到队爷们总说:“想出题目不要激动,仔细想想有什么问题,最好再手算下样例”,我立马就hack掉了,甚者第三个样例就可以hack,这不就是出题人明摆着:“我已经发现了你的骗分意图,我友善地提醒你我发现了,你不会有分的”,然后就打了个退火……甚至不想打后边的那10分

t2发现了些性质,列了个dp,但不知道如何处理循环的限制……然后鸽到最后一刻才打,暴力都没交……

t3理解了个错题意(题目想表达的意思:对于每种情况计算再相加;我根据题面理解的意思:先算概率再计算),然后……我果然没过大样例,但我没发现题意的问题,打了三个完全不同的做法,都得到了一样的答案,但就是过不了样例……爆零了……自闭了……

出来发现t1那个贪心合并凸包的做法有65!?┌(。Д。)┐不过毛爷爷的塑普好严重呐

自闭了

Day3

豪华阵容评审团再发尬问:“为啥你们校这二十年来就没有国家队”、“虽然你是第一啊,但你不一定就能选上啊(潜在台词:虽然你拿了NOI第一、即使你拿了WC第一、即使你又拿了CTS第一,我不想让你上,你就是上不了)”、“实数怎么取膜?”

三题爆炸后总分 \(141\),Ag线 \(145\),有d2t1那65就有Au?自闭了……

游记-pkupc&cts2019的更多相关文章

  1. THUPC2019/CTS2019/APIO2019/PKUSC2019游记

    THUPC2019/CTS2019/APIO2019/PKUSC2019游记 5.10 中铺,火车好晃啊 5.11 打了THUPC2019的练习赛,华容道好评(四个小兵,杠鸭!) 5.12 打了THU ...

  2. THUPC2019/CTS2019/APIO2019游记

    Day -? 居然还能报上thupc,我在队里唯一的作用大约是cfrating稍微高点方便过审.另外两位是lz和xyy. Day -2 我夫人生日! Day -1 lz和xyy的家长都来了带我飞.住在 ...

  3. 【20161203-20161208】清华集训2016滚粗记&&酱油记&&游记

    先挖坑(这个blog怎么变成游记专用了--) 已更完 #include <cstdio> using namespace std; int main(){ puts("转载请注明 ...

  4. 【20160722-20160728】NOI2016滚粗记&&酱油记&&游记

    先挖坑 #include <cstdio> using namespace std; int main(){ puts("转载请注明出处:http://www.cnblogs.c ...

  5. NOIp2016 游记

    DAY -2 不要问我为什么现在就开了一篇博客. 本来想起个NOIp2016爆零记或者NOIp2016退役记之类的,但是感觉现在不能乱立flag了.所以就叫游记算了. 前几场模拟赛崩了一场又一场,RP ...

  6. NOIP2016游记

    只是游记而已.流水账. Day0:忘了. Day1:看完T1,本以为T2一如既往很简单,结果看了半天完全没有思路.然后看了一眼T3,期望,NOIP什么时候要考期望了,于是接着看T2.一开始我推的限制条 ...

  7. CTSC2016&&APIO2016滚粗记&&酱油记&&游记<del>(持续更新)</del>

    挖一波坑 #include <cstdio> using namespace std; int main(){ puts("转载请注明出处:http://www.cnblogs. ...

  8. 游记——noip2016

    2016.11.18 (day 0) 呆在家. 悠闲地呆在家.. 明后天可能出现的错误: 1)没打freopen.打了ctime: 2)对拍程序忘记怎么写了...忘记随机化种子怎么写了: 3)不知道厕 ...

  9. 【NOIP 2015 & SDOI 2016 Round1 & CTSC 2016 & SDOI2016 Round2】游记

    我第一次写游记,,,, 正文在哪里?正文在哪里?正文在哪里?正文在哪里?正文在哪里?正文在哪里?正文在哪里?正文在哪里?正文在哪里?正文在哪里?正文在哪里?正文在哪里?正文在哪里?正文在哪里?正文在哪 ...

随机推荐

  1. [大数据相关] Hive中的全排序:order by,sort by, distribute by

    写mapreduce程序时,如果reduce个数>1,想要实现全排序需要控制好map的输出,详见Hadoop简单实现全排序. 现在学了hive,写sql大家都很熟悉,如果一个order by解决 ...

  2. IOS开发环境

    当我们需要帮一些人学习IOS的时候,可以翻阅下这篇文章,我有个同学对IOS开发不太了解,用语言描述该怎么做的时候显得不够具体,或者全部需要我帮忙操作,又会占用我们的时间,如果每个人都这么要求的话,那么 ...

  3. java基础类型源码解析之String

    差点忘了最常用的String类型,我们对String的大多数方法都已经很熟了,这里就挑几个平时不会直接接触的点来解析一下. 先来看看它的成员变量 public final class String { ...

  4. Filename too long Resolution

    在git bash中,运行下列命令: git config --global core.longpaths true --global是该参数的使用范围,如果只对本版本库设置该参数,只要在上述命令中去 ...

  5. maven手动将jar包导入到本地仓库(支持多个仓库选择)

    正常我们在用maven搭建项目时,我们只需要将项目所需要的依赖配置到maven的配置文件pom.xml中即可,maven就可以去网上将jar包下载到配置的本地仓库中去.所以一般情况下我们是不需要手动安 ...

  6. Microsoft Visual C++ Runtime library not enough space for thread data

    Microsoft Visual C++ Runtime library not enough space for thread data     电脑最近一直在运行的时候,弹出提示框,如下: 解决办 ...

  7. Tomcat中配置URIEncoding="UTF-8"来处理中文的处理

    Tomcat中配置URIEncoding="UTF-8"来处理中文的处理 打开 server.xml 文件,更改两个地方. 配置一:添加 URIEncoding="UTF ...

  8. Civil 3D百度云地址

    Civil 3D 2018百度云地址 https://pan.baidu.com/s/1edeVhG Civil 3D 2019注册机百度云地址 链接: https://pan.baidu.com/s ...

  9. Qt编写自定义控件37-发光按钮(会呼吸的痛)

    一.前言 这个控件是好早以前写的,已经授权过好几个人开源过此控件代码,比如红磨坊小胖,此控件并不是来源于真实需求,而仅仅是突发奇想,类似于星星的闪烁,越到边缘越来越淡,定时器动态改变边缘发光的亮度,产 ...

  10. Python - Django - 编辑作者

    在作者列表页面的操作栏中加上编辑按钮 <!DOCTYPE html> <html lang="en"> <head> <meta char ...